Tokyo is ready to consider a response to a statement by US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ent, who called on Japan to completely abandon purchases of Russian energy carriers.
The corresponding statement was published by Kyodo news agency, citing government sources in the Japanese delegation to Washington. At the same time, no specifics followed.
"In cooperation with the G7 countries, Japan will consider what can be done," one of the agency's interlocutors said vaguely.
Recall that currently in LNG is supplied to Japan from the Sakhalin-2 project, which accounts for about 9% of all LNG imports. In the land of the Rising Sun, this is motivated by energy security.
As EADaily reported, earlier, US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ent, at a meeting with his Japanese counterpart Katsunobu Kato, said that Washington expects Tokyo to refuse to purchase energy from the Russian Federation.
